Senior Events Manager - Matterport, Singapore

Matterport, a CoStar Group (NASDAQ: CSGP) brand, is transforming the built world through its pioneering 3D digital twin and AI driven spatial data platform. By combining immersive technology, precision data, and advanced visualization capabilities, Matterport empowers professionals across commercial real estate, retail, hospitality, design, and construction to market, manage, and analyze properties in entirely new ways. Matterport is a leading digital transformation platform that turns buildings into immersive digital twins, improving every part of the building lifecycle-from planning and construction to operations, documentation, appraisal and marketing.

Overview

The Senior Events Manager will lead the planning, coordination and execution of trade shows, corporate events and regional activations for Matterport across all APJ markets. Based full time at Matterport's Singapore office, the role reports directly to the Director of Marketing and works closely with sales teams in each APJ market and with the CoStar Group centralized Events & Sponsorship team in the U.S. to ensure alignment, consistency and excellence in event execution and brand representation.
